JJC WR-100 WIRELESS CONTROLLER
Thank you for purchasing JJC WR-100 series wireless controller. For the best performance, please
read this instruction carefully before use.
Remove the remote control socket cap of the camera.
Take out the JJC WR-100 wireless controller receiver and plug it into the remote control socket of the
camera.
Slide the function button in the W Mode. The receiver is active. Under this condition, the receiver can
receive the signal from the transmitter; the receiver consumes the power of the battery. User can uses
the Shutter button of the transmitter and Focus button to control the Camera's shutter and Focus.
Press the transmitter's shutter button to take a photo. Press the transmitter's focus button to focus.
Slide the function button in the O Mode. The receiver is turnoff. Under this condition, the transmitter
can not active the receiver to control the camera. The receiver will not consume any power of the
battery. User can use the shutter button of the receiver to take photos. Press the shutter button
halfway to focus. Press it fully to take a photo.
Slide the function button in the L Mode and turn on the camera to BULB mode. Under this condition,
the transmitter opens the lens; Slid the function button in the O Mode, the transmitter closes the lens.

  • Page 2 Charging The WR-100 inbuilt High Capacity Li-ion battery. Take out the power adapter, plug it into the power socket of the transmitter and then plug the power adapter to the power outlet. When the transmitter is under charging, the light of transmitter is on.
